Sibridge Technologies Enhances Ethernet IP Cores with IEEE 1588 PTP

SANTA CLARA, Calif., March 3, 2014 - Sibridge Technologies a leading provider of innovative design IPs, verification IPs, VLSI and embedded systems solutions, for the development of SoC platform products, today announced availability of IEEE 1588-2008 Precision Time Protocol (PTP). The addition of IEEE 1588-2008 to Sibridge Technologies' Design IP portfolio will enable Sibridge to support existing customers and acquire new customers in the networking domain. Customer will leverage IEEE 1588-2008 IP for real-time networking and automation applications that involve very precise timing synchronization.

 

Sibridge Technologies' IEEE 1588 IP seamlessly couples with its Triple-speed Ethernet IP and variety of interfaces like MII/GMII/RMII/RGMII/TBI PHY interface data-paths for detecting PTP messages. The design comprises of highly accurate adder-based clock, network packet interface specific PTP-message-event capture logic, AHB/AXI system interface controller and time-stamp mechanism. The IP core also supports time-stamping based on external events, provides user-programmable clock-output/trigger-pulse, and a Pulse per Second (PPS) output.

 

"Proliferation of Ethernet for variety of applications makes IEEE 1588-2008 as a must have IP protocol for highly time-critical applications. Our IEEE 1588-2008 IP is highly configurable and allows easy customization to target variety of application." said Rajesh Shah, CEO of Sibridge Technologies.

About Sibridge Design and Verification IP Solutions

 

Sibridge's Design IPs (DIPs) are high performance cores with low gate count and low power. The DIPs are based on a robust IP development methodology that enables the DIPs to be highly configurable and easy to integrate in complex SoCs. 

 

Sibridge's Verification IPs (VIPs) leverages the power of SystemVerilog to provide verification engineers with a highly scalable, expandable and easy to use verification solution. The VIPs are native SystemVerilog based solutions that support UVM, OVM, VMM and Pure SystemVerilog methodology.
